Santa Paula is an agricultural city in the Santa Clara River Valley in Ventura County, approximately 15 miles east of Ventura, that has maintained its identity as a citrus growing center and a city with a well-preserved historic downtown more successfully than most California agricultural communities that have faced the same pressures of suburban development. The city’s approximately 31,000 residents live in a community where the working citrus orchards and lemon packing houses that gave the city its agricultural character are still visible, and where the California Oil Museum and the Aviation Museum of Santa Paula reflect the industrial and transportation history of the valley.
The California Oil Museum, in a historic former Union Oil Company service station building on Main Street, documents the history of the California petroleum industry from its origins in the Santa Paula area, where the first commercial oil well in California was drilled in 1876. The museum’s collection and programming reflect Santa Paula’s position as one of the birthplaces of the California oil industry and a historical character that connects the contemporary agricultural city to the industrial history of the state.
The Aviation Museum of Santa Paula, at the Santa Paula Airport adjacent to the city, maintains a collection of antique and historic aircraft operated by a volunteer community of pilots and aviation enthusiasts. The airport, one of the more active general aviation facilities in Ventura County, supports flight training, private flying, and the museum’s educational programming in an open-hangar format that allows visitors to see historic aircraft in a working maintenance and storage environment.
The downtown commercial district on Main Street, preserved through the city’s historic district designation, contains a mix of independent retailers, restaurants, and the historic buildings that reflect the commercial architecture of the late nineteenth and early twentieth century agricultural service town. The Santa Paula Farmers Market, held on Saturdays, connects the community to the agricultural production of the surrounding valley in a direct way that reflects the city’s ongoing agricultural character.

The Steckel Park in Santa Paula, operated by the county of Ventura, provides a large-lot camping, picnicking, and creek access environment that serves the recreational needs of the surrounding community and draws visitors from throughout the county. The park’s position along the Santa Clara River corridor and the camping infrastructure that allows overnight stays make it one of the more complete outdoor recreation facilities in the inland Ventura County area.
The Santa Paula Airport, a general aviation facility on the northeastern edge of the city, supports a community of private pilots and is home to the Aviation Museum of Santa Paula’s aircraft collection. The airport’s historic role as a primary aviation facility in the Santa Clara Valley, combined with the museum’s focus on the history of California aviation, gives Santa Paula a connection to aviation history that is unusual in an agricultural city of its size.
Santa Paula’s position approximately 15 miles east of Ventura and 35 miles west of the San Fernando Valley via the SR-126 gives it commute access to both employment areas, though the drive time on the SR-126 through the agricultural valley terrain can vary significantly depending on traffic and weather conditions. Buyers who are employed in the Oxnard, Ventura, or Camarillo area will find Santa Paula’s commute more practical than buyers whose employment requires regular travel to the San Fernando Valley or Los Angeles basin.
